1/4 mile again

So I took the s to the track. I wanted to see what it would do with the sc. My first run was a 15 flat at 106 hahahaha. When I launched it wheel hopped very very badly so badly the radio cover popped open and it popped outa gear I then put it in 2nd gunned it and it popped out again because of wheel hop. Second run I had horrible wheel hop again to the point I had to get off the gas ran a 14 flat at 111. Third run I took off from the tree like id leave a traffic light then gunned it got a 2.2 60 but when i shifted hard into second it grabbed drove 10 feet the wheel hopped bad so I had to get off the gas ran a 13.6 at 109. 4th and final run I lowered my tire pressure alot launched at 4k rpm got a 2.2 60 foot time ran a 13 flat in the quarter at 112.


So the bad news is me and my tires suck at launching the good news is im getting awesome trap speeds.
